Airbnb Seasonality

In Stafford, Virginia, the Airbnb market experiences a distinct seasonality that aligns with the region's climate and local events. The peak season typically begins in late spring and extends through the summer months, coinciding with the warm weather and the influx of tourists visiting the area's historical sites, parks, and festivals. During this period, Airbnb hosts can expect higher occupancy rates and the opportunity to charge premium prices. Conversely, the off-peak season, which spans the colder months of late fall and winter, sees a decrease in tourism and subsequently, a drop in rental demand. However, this period can still yield steady bookings from business travelers and those visiting family for the holidays. Understanding these seasonal trends can help hosts in Stafford optimize their pricing strategies and maximize their rental income.

Short Term Rental Regulations

In Stafford, Virginia, Airbnb hosts must be aware of and comply with a variety of local regulations. The county requires that all short-term rental properties be registered, and hosts must obtain a business license from the Commissioner of the Revenue. Additionally, hosts are responsible for collecting and remitting a 5% Transient Occupancy Tax on all bookings. It's also important to note that Stafford County has zoning laws that may affect the ability to host on Airbnb, particularly in residential areas. Therefore, it's crucial to check with the Stafford County Zoning Department to ensure your property is zoned appropriately for short-term rentals.

Best Practices for Management

In the Stafford, Virginia market, managing Airbnb properties requires a keen understanding of the local dynamics. The area's proximity to military bases and Washington D.C. creates a unique demand for short-term rentals, often fluctuating with government activities and military rotations. Challenges include maintaining competitive pricing during off-peak seasons and ensuring properties meet the specific needs of government and military personnel. Key tips for success include staying updated on local events and government activities, offering flexible check-in/out times to accommodate unpredictable schedules, and providing amenities that cater to the needs of this unique demographic, such as high-speed internet and work-friendly spaces.

Locations and Amenities

In Stafford, Virginia, the Airbnb market thrives on the area's rich history and natural beauty. Properties that highlight amenities such as proximity to historical sites, like George Washington's Ferry Farm, or outdoor attractions, such as the Government Island or Aquia Landing Park, tend to be popular among guests. Additionally, amenities that cater to the large military community, such as flexible check-in times or discounts for extended stays, can set a property apart. Given Stafford's location between Washington, D.C. and Richmond, properties that offer convenient access to major highways or public transportation are also highly sought after.

What is vacation rental property management?

Vacation rental property management is a service provider that maintains and improves a vacation rental on behalf of owners. They manage the ongoing operation, marketing, maintenance, and promotion of a vacation rental, short-term rental, or Airbnb property.

How long does the onboarding process take?

The onboarding process usually takes 2-4 weeks. This gives the manager and owner ample time to inspect the property, get it ready for guests, and get the listing live. In the event that owners need additional time to furnish or otherwise improve the property, the onboarding process can be extended.

Will I get a smart lock?

Yes, most managers provide a smart lock. This helps them operate the home and seamlessly let guests in. While there is some upfront expense associated with the lock and some additional time to set it up, there’s nothing worse than a guest not being able to access the property when they arrive.

Will they take updated photos of the property?

In most cases, your manager will hire a professional photographer to do a shoot at the home. This happens after the home is both cleaned and staged for photography. This helps the home stand out on vacation rental booking sites and results in better bookings overall. If you have really high-quality photos already, you can skip this step in the onboarding process.
